Description

  • An innovative LEEP electrode, the Fischer cone biopsy excisor (FCBE) comes in a variety of sizes and shapes for precise cone biopsy specimens
  • Smooth, 360° rotating motion removes a perfect, cone-shaped cervical specimen in seconds
  • Linear wire electrode stays rigid and makes a clean, precise cut with little or no bleeding and less thermal artifact for easier pathology evaluation and simplified tissue analysis
  • Stop arm provides firm support and added stability for the wire electrode, resulting in better control and smoother cutting
  • Arm curvature permits precise instrument positioning and allows for unobstructed visualization during procedure
  • Shaft and stop arm are fully insulated to protect endocervical canal and underlying vaginal structures
